I'm sure you remember this fine still active WIP thread by Wolf-girl:

http://leadadventureforum.com/index.php?topic=15132.0

Should be able to get plastic or styrene brick pattern at Tammies' to put under some sections of crumbling adobe.  Should also be able to order 1:48 scale Plaststruct Spanish tile roofing material through Tammies' and use it to make alternate roofs to put over the flate roofs so that the buildings can do double duty (tiled roofs in Italy, Spain, the Carribean, or the Spanish Main, or flat roofs in North or East Africa, the Middle-East, or parts of Mexico).

Speaking of Spanish buildings, I saw some fabulous Spanish style buildings the last three years or so at the NHMGS Enfilade convention in Olympia, Washington, as part of a western gunfight game.  The resin building kits were designed by Company B, better known for it's WW2 vehicles, but the Spanish style buildings are not on the Company B web site.  The resin kits were being sold at the convention by Monday Knight Productions, which is based in Vancouver, Washington, and Milwaukie, Oregon, but the resin building kits are not on the MKP web site either.  I know there were several unsold Spanish style 28mm size resin kits at the end of the convention, so maybe it would be worth a telephone call to enquire about them:

Just a note about the Miniature Building Authority Spanish Main buildings, some of which might be useful to you: at the moment, they're pre-orders due out in September.  So possibly not your best bet if you're in a rush.  We saw them in the flesh at Historicon and frankly, we ordered the lot. (OK, we were going to do that anyway, but that's beside the point.)  We also picked up some of the Brigade Games buildings, which have yet to be assembled.  Dry-fitting seems to suggest they won't be too horrible to get together.
